Manchester United Survives FA Cup Scare Against Coventry

Manchester United reached the FA Cup final after a dramatic match against Coventry City. The Red Devils initially held a comfortable 3-0 lead. However, Coventry mounted an impressive comeback to tie the game 3-3. The match went to extra time and then penalties. Manchester United ultimately prevailed, winning the shootout.

The game took place at Wembley Stadium. Manchester United will now face Manchester City in the final. This sets up a Manchester derby for the FA Cup title.

Match Summary

Manchester United appeared to be cruising to victory. Goals from Scott McTominay, Harry Maguire, and Bruno Fernandes put them firmly in control. However, Coventry City showed great resilience. They fought back with goals from Ellis Simms, Callum O’Hare, and a late penalty from Haji Wright.

Dramatic Comeback

Coventry’s comeback stunned Manchester United. The Championship side displayed determination and quality. Their late surge forced extra time, showcasing their fighting spirit.

Extra Time and Penalties

Extra time saw both teams create chances. A potential Coventry winner was disallowed for a marginal offside. The game then went to a penalty shootout. Manchester United goalkeeper Andre Onana made a crucial save. Manchester United won the shootout 4-2, securing their place in the final.

Manchester Derby in the Final

The FA Cup final will be a Manchester derby. Manchester United will face their rivals, Manchester City. Manchester City are the current holders of the FA Cup. The final promises to be a thrilling encounter.

Erik ten Hag’s Perspective

Manchester United manager Erik ten Hag acknowledged his team’s performance fluctuations. He highlighted periods of control and moments where they relinquished their grip on the game. Ten Hag will aim to prepare his team for the challenge posed by Manchester City.

Looking Ahead

Manchester United will need to improve their consistency. They aim to win the FA Cup. The match against Manchester City will be a significant test. Coventry City, despite the loss, earned praise for their spirited performance.
